Abstract

By means of GeXP (gene expression profiling),quantitative analysis was carried out to investigate the gene expression on pheochromocytoma/paraganglioma specimens.30 samples were collectcd from 16 patients with benign pheochromocytoma and 14 with malignant pheochromocytoma/paraganglioma.Our results suggest that lower expressions of genes encoding peptide processing factors including QPCT,HSPA4L,RNF6 and RNF128 in pheochromocytomas/paragangliomas may point to a malignant diagnosis. Key words: Pheochromocytoma; Differential diagnosis; Gene expression profiling; Gene expression
